#!/bin/bash# analysis the mysql slow log# Writen by landline#IPadd=`grep `hostname`  /etc/hosts | awk -F' '  'END{print $1}' `IPadd=`/sbin/ifconfig eth0 |grep Bcast |awk -F: '{print $2}'|awk
原创 2014-11-14 18:55:08
617阅读
#!/bin/bashLOG=/diskb/mysql/slowlog/   #定义日志存储路径DATE=`date +"%Y-%m-%d"`   #定义时间参数user=root                             &
原创 2017-02-25 16:58:17
763阅读
1、PHP脚本日志·        间歇性的502,是后端 PHP-FPM 不可用造成的,间歇性的502一般认为是由于 PHP-FPM 进程重启造成的。·        在 PHP-FPM 的子进程数目超过的配置中的数量时候,会出现间歇性
转载 精选 2015-05-28 13:53:28
567阅读
1、PHP脚本日志 间歇性的502,是后端 PHP-FPM 不可用造成的,间歇性的502一般认为是由于 PHP-FPM 进程重启造成的。 在 PHP-FPM 的子进程数目超过的配置中的数量时候,会出现间歇性的502错误,如果在配置中设置了max_requests的话,超过数量也会出现502错误,而max_requests的设置,正是为了防止不安全的第三方library脚本的 内存泄露 ,当然你自
原创 2016-01-16 20:57:37
2565阅读
1点赞
1评论
       公司线上的 MySQL 日志,之前一直没有做好监控。趁着上周空闲,我就把监控脚本写了下,今天特地把代码发出来与51博友分享一下。       针对脚本的注解和整体构思,我会放到脚本之后为大家详解。#!/bin/bash # # 本脚本用来在指定频率内监控 MySQL 日志
推荐 原创 2014-11-17 11:10:42
8253阅读
8点赞
8评论
公司线上的 MySQL 日志,之前一直没有做好监控。趁着上周空闲,我就把监控脚本写了下,今天特地把代码发出来与51博友分享一下。 针对脚本的注解和整体构思,我会放到脚本之后为大家详解。123456789101112131415161718192021222324252627282930313...
转载 2014-11-17 15:09:00
65阅读
2评论
       公司线上的 MySQL 日志,之前一直没有做好监控。趁着上周空闲,我就把监控脚本写了下,今天特地把代码发出来与51博友分享一下。       针对脚本的注解和整体构思,我会放到脚本之后为大家详解。#!/bin/bash # # 本脚本用来在指定频率内监控 MySQL 日志
转载 精选 2014-11-25 09:55:13
274阅读
分析Mysql日志是运维工作中,不可少的。要快速定位Sql,以及发现后优化Sql及修改业务,保证数据库稳定高效地工作。下面是我工作中解决的思路...1.先查看本地数据库日志文件2.编写分析日志脚本#!/usr/bin/python #coding=utf-8  #字符编码 import re  #导入正则匹配模块 import s
原创 精选 2014-10-09 09:51:39
2869阅读
5点赞
3评论
       MySQL查询日志MySQL提供的一种日志记录,它用来记录在MySQL中响应时间超过阀值的语句,具体指运行时间超过long_query_time值的SQL,则会被记录到查询日志中。long_query_time的默认值为10,意思是运行10S以上的语句。默认情况下,Mysql数据库并不启动查询日志,需要我们手动来设置这个参数,当然,如
转载 2023-08-20 14:08:07
107阅读
Mysql日志介绍: MySQL 提供的一种日志记录,它用来记录在 MySQL 中响应时间超过阀值的语句,具体指运行时间超过long_query_time值的 SQL,则会被记录到查询日志中。long_query_time的默认值为10,意思是运行10s以上的语句。 默认情况下,MySQL 数据库并不启动查询日志,需要我们手动来设置这个参数,当然,如果不是调优需要的话,一般不建议启动该参数,
1、查询日志介绍数据库查询快慢是影响项目性能的一大因素,对于数据库,我们除了要优化  SQL,更重要的是得先找到需要优化的SQL。MySQL数据库有一个“查询日志”功能,用来记录查询时间超过某个设定值的SQL语句,这将极大程度帮助我们快速定位到症结所在,以便对症下药。至于查询时间的多少才算,每个项目、业务都有不同的要求。MySQL查询日志功能默认是关闭的,需要手动开启。2、开启
转载 2023-07-28 12:52:28
376阅读
MySQL查询日志MySQL提供的一种日志记录,它用来记录在MySQL中响应时间超过阀值的语句,具体指运行时间超过long_query_time值的SQL,则会被记录到查询日志中。long_query_time的默认值为10,意思是运行10S以上的语句。默认情况下,Mysql数据库并不启动查询日志,需要我们手动来设置这个参数,当然,如果不是调优需要的话,一般不建议启动该参数,因为开启
转载 2024-05-17 16:41:42
175阅读
完整的日志格式一般如下:1 # Time: 130320 7:30:26 2 # User@Host: db_user[db_database] @ localhost [] 3 # Query_time: 4.545309 Lock_time: 0.000069 Rows_sent: 219 Rows_examined: 254 4 SET timestamp=1363779026; 5
转载 2023-06-02 10:09:05
325阅读
一、什么是查询日志?  查询日志官方给出的理解太费劲了,本博主,按照日常思维进行一下讲解吧,查询日志顾名思义,就是查询日志记录啊,我们在数据库中的增删改查等操作,如果执行时间超过了数据库中查询设置的默认查询时间之后,就会把这些执行较慢的sql记录到日志中,像这样的日志叫做查询日志。这么一说,大家应该比较好理解了吧,哈哈。二、查询有哪些参数配置?  MySQL 查询的相关参数解释:
转载 2023-10-22 18:47:11
55阅读
一、mysql查询           MySQL查询日志MySQL提供的一种日志记录,它用来记录在MySQL中响应时间超过阀值的语句,具体指运行时间超过long_query_time值的SQL,则会被记录到查询日志中。long_query_time的默认值为10,意思是运行10S以上的语句。默认情况下,Mysql数据库并不启
日志系统表Mysql 安装后会有一个系统数据库 【mysql】 ,其中包含两张系统日志表分别为:general_log: 常规查询日志表 slow_log: 查询日志表这两张表分别可以记录客户端的常规查询日志,及查询过慢(具体时长有参数配置)的日志;默认日志是记录到日志文件,而不是到数据库日志表指定目的地设置将日志输出到日志文件 还是 系统日志表log-output=name
一、概念MYSQL查询:全名是查询日志,是MySQL提供的一种日志记录,用来记录在MySQL中响应时间超过阀值的语句。,具体指运行时间超过long_query_time值的SQL,则会被记录到查询日志中。long_query_time的默认值为10,意思是运行10S以上的语句。默认情况下,Mysql数据库并不启动查询日志,需要我们手动来设置这个参数,当然,如果不是调优需要的话,一般不建议启
转载 2023-08-07 08:55:53
156阅读
对于MySQL的一般查询日志查询日志,开启比较简单,其中公用的一个参数是log_output,log_output控制着查询和一般查询日志的输出方向可以是表(mysql.general_log,mysql.slow_log)或者文件(有参数general_log_file和slow_query_log_file配置决定)或者同时输出到表和文件(想不明白,什么时候需要同时输出到表和文件)。但是
MySQL查询日志MySQL提供的一种日志记录,它用来记录在MySQL中响应时间超过阀值的语句,具体指运行时间超过long_query_time值的SQL,则会被记录到查询日志中。long_query_time的默认值为10,意思是运行10S以上的语句。 默认情况下,MySQL数据库并不启动查询日志,需要我们手动来设置这个参数,当然,如果不是调优需要的话,一般不建议启动该参数,
1. 概述MySQL查询日志MySQL提供的一种日志记录,它用来记录在MySQL中响应时间超过阀值的语句。 具体指运行时间超过long_query_time值的SQL,则会被记录到查询日志中。long_query_time的默认值为10,意思是运行10s以上的语句。就会被认作是查询。 默认情况下,mysql数据库并不启动查询日志,需要我们手动来设置这个参数,如果不是调优需要的话,一般不
  • 1
  • 2
  • 3
  • 4
  • 5